Work has continued to modify the track arrangements on the south end of the layout. The link
from the short line runaround loop is in and is fully usable, the final step is to install the point
motors on the two new points. The replacement trackwork for the double slip has been more
problematic. You may remember that in the last Train Orders I said that Steve and I were not
happy with the layout or appearance of the tracks replacing the double slip. We removed what we
had laid and started again. The revised layout looks better and has larger radius curves through
that section than either the original track layout or the first revision.


For the coming Sunday meet there is no connection to the end of the caboose loop but it is
possible to run through the two station platforms.
